Funky, Colorful Bedroom
A drab apartment bedroom is redesigned into a funky, glamorous boudoir. The Design on a Dime team signs on to give Susie, an aspiring actress, a boudoir fit for a starlet, for less than $1,000.

Design coordinator Spencer Anderson uses medium density fiberboard (MDF) to build display shelving for Susie's purses and shoes. He gives the shelves a coat of teal paint and installs low-profile lighting to highlight the collections. Lastly, the faces of the units are framed using gold spray-painted molding.
